About Ravinder Jerath

Ravinder Jerath is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Endocrine and Autonomic Systems,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Clinical Psychology, having authored 36 papers that have together received 992 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neural dynamics and brain function (14 papers), Heart Rate Variability and Autonomic Control (10 papers), Sleep and Wakefulness Research (8 papers), Mindfulness and Compassion Interventions (6 papers), Neuroscience of respiration and sleep (6 papers), Photoreceptor and optogenetics research (5 papers), EEG and Brain-Computer Interfaces (5 papers) and Visual perception and processing mechanisms (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cognitive Neuroscience (278 citations),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(81 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(233 cit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(144 citations) and Clinical Psychology (219 citations). Ravinder Jerath has collaborated with scholars based in United States, India and Antigua and Barbuda. Frequent co-authors include Vernon A. Barnes, Molly W. Crawford and Hossam E Fadel. Their work appears in journals such as Frontiers in Human Neuroscience, Frontiers in Psychiatry, Frontiers in Psychology, Consciousness and Cognition and Sleep Medicine.
